These mesmerizing photos of the Milky Way have all been captured by one man from Canada who drives for hours to take pictures of the galaxy in its most beautiful state.
Gary Cummins uses his knowledge and experience to “chase down” the Milky Way—traveling for hours to capture the spectacular display against a host of iconic backdrops.

The 38-year-old, who used to live in Ireland but now lives in Toronto, has already “tracked” the Milky Way all over the world, taking captivating shots across Ireland, California, and Canada. He now hopes to do the same in Saudi Arabia, Europe, and more specifically Easter Island.
Gary, who works in construction to fund his unusual hobby, said: “There’s something very special about it. I can’t really put it into words.”
“Being out under the stars at night, wondering what’s out there is part of it,” he added. “Also telling a story and filling people’s imaginations with awe and wonder is another.”

He went on to further explain that it’s something you come to appreciate, no matter which part of the world you reside in.
Describing the process, Gary said that, initially, it was “tough,” as he wasn’t very well informed and had little knowledge about it. However, as time passed and as he went through more adventures, the process also became a lot “easier.”

Gary laments that, currently, he is not in the best location in terms of proximity.
“I have to drive for at least two hours to get to dark enough areas compared to my hometown in Ireland where I’m only twenty minutes away,” Gary said. “It’s just part of the journey I guess. If you want the shot you have to go get it.”
Apart from sharing his stunning photos of the Milky Way on Instagram, Gary also conducts workshops on Astrophotography for anyone who is interested in capturing the beauty of the night sky.
